STATE OF PLAY | Natasha Marrian: Why Zuma won't last
Jacob Zuma will inflict damage on the ANC , which it deserves after shielding him and elevating him over the country for more than a decade, but that is where it will end. SA is not the ANC . There is no going back now for Zuma, argues Jacob Zuma 's uMkhonto weSizwe Party's prime objective is inflicting maximum damage on the ANC , not longevity.
